Scenario:
Playing in the asiatic fleet, and now am now in early 1942. I'm sent to patrol in the south chinese sea. I kill a 8kt freighter with my deck gun before arriving, and then I stumble upon a convoy: 4 fubukis, a large liner of some sort. I report it, and get told to down some escorts to soften it for another attack... I go in and get spotted voluntarily to attract the escorts so I can fight them one by one. I damage one enough that he turns and goes back to the liner. Fine, I'll get him later.
I sink the next two (completing the objective), but the last is on me and I don't have a good angle, so I go deep and start making my way to the liner and damaged escort to try to get those. I manage to evade the DD, and I get to about 8000 yards away from him. I save here, considering myself lucky enough to have gotten those two escorts.
Problem: they're too fast. And then suddenly, the damaged fubuki sinks (and I get that nice kill icon on the map). Well ok then, I'll get the last one, then gun down the liner. I surface to attract the last escort, and he comes steaming along at over 30 knots. When he's close enough, I launch one torpedo from my stern tubes. Hit, but he's still floating. Another. Hit! And a big explosion! And... CTD? Dammit!
So I start again from my save and repeat the same steps... and I crash at exactly the same moment: right after the last DD gets hit by my second torpedo.
Third time's a charm, right? I try to make my own luck, though: I saved right after my torpedo hit, but before any crash... And crash again. Reload from my save... crash three seconds in (I barely had enough time to swing my periscope around to see him sink).
TL;DR: I crash right when a certain destroyer escort (presumably) sinks from my torpedoes in a certain way, and it happens every time, even when loading from save. Perhaps there is a link with the fact that I was assigned to hurt the escort, but now I've completely killed it?
Hardware:
P4 3.2ghz
1.5gb RAM
Radeon x300 128mb VRAM (Yes, I know it's bad, but it's int he list of the officially supported video cards... Yes, I lag somewhat).
Drivers are updated.
Using SHIV 1.5 (I have U-Boat missions) and RSRDC (installed with JSGME). If it is of any importance, I have the steam version.
Any help? I'm going to try just not looking that the escort as it sinks... maybe it's just a rendering bug of some sort.
EDIT: Never mind, just tried, I crashed without even looking at my periscope.
